The video tutorial includes the step-by-step procedure of building a custom module in Odoo version 13. Covers the areas of Models and field declarations, menus and various views (form, tree, search), security groups, and access rights. The video covers the region of the composition of the basic structure of the module, and the creation of the module structure using the scaffold command method. It also discusses the relational mapping between the objects along with the field type and field declarations. Beginners will get a clear idea about creating views and corresponding actions through this video.
